The Órgiva City Council has announced the opening of the application period for the 2026 Business Aid, which will commence on July 27. This initiative is designed to support small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) and self-employed individuals in the town.
The aid will be distributed across four main lines: Digital SME, focused on digitalization; Innova SME, to foster innovation; Sustainable SME, aimed at sustainability; and Xpande Digital, for the internationalization of businesses.
This represents a significant opportunity for local businesses to enhance their competitiveness in strategic areas. Interested parties will be able to review the details of each program and process the aid that best suits their needs starting from the indicated date.
It is important to note that, according to the information provided, aid will be granted on a first-come, first-served basis this year, emphasizing the importance of submitting applications promptly.
